In the quarterfinals of the 2025 Sudirman Cup, South Korea will face Denmark, and if you want to win the championship, only An Seying may not be enough

The Korean badminton team, commanded by coach Park Joo-bong, will face Denmark in the quarterfinals of the 2025 Sudirman Cup World Badminton Mixed Team Championships. The Korean Badminton Association said on the 2nd that the opponent of the South Korean team was Denmark in a Sudirman Cup round of 8 match held at the Xiamen Olympic Sports Center in China on the afternoon of the 2nd.

On April 24, at the second terminal of Incheon International Airport, the South Korean team participating in the 2025 Su Cup took a group photo before going abroad.

The South Korean team, which competed with the Czech Republic, Canada and Chinese Taipei in the group stage of this year's Soviet Cup, won the first place in Group B with three wins and entered the top 8 knockout rounds. If Denmark is defeated in the round of 8, South Korea will face the winner between Thailand and Indonesia in the semifinals. If they reach the final, they are likely to meet the defending champions, the favourites to win the tournament, China.

Each Sudirman Cup will be played in five badminton events, including men's singles, women's singles, men's doubles, women's doubles, and mixed doubles, and the first side to win three sets will win. South Korean media believe that for the national team, ace player Ahn Se Ying got rid of injury and returned to competitive form is a good factor.

The 2025 Su Cup is the debut stage of Park Joo-bong, who was selected as the head coach of the Korean national team last month

As of the All England Open Badminton Championships in March this year, An Xiying has achieved the great feat of women's singles in international competitions for 4 consecutive times this season, and due to the impact of a muscle injury in the inner thigh, An Xiying missed the previous 2025 Asian Championships individual event, concentrated on recovering her body, and returned to the field through this competition.

An Se Ying, who missed the group stage match against the Czech Republic in the first round, played the women's singles against Canada and Chinese Taipei, and both won 2-0, showing an overwhelming competitive form. The tournament is Ahn Se-young's comeback stage and the debut stage for Park Joo-bong, who was selected as the head coach of the Korean national team last month.

An Se Young may not be enough to save the South Korean team


The South Korean team lost to China in the final of the last Soviet Cup held in 2023 and finished as runners-up. The last time South Korea lifted the trophy was in 2017, when they defeated China 3-2 in the final. Although the South Korean team has the world's first sister An Seying to press the lineup, there is a big shortcoming in the team - there is really no player in the team who can do it in the men's singles, and the three group games of this year's Su Cup, the Korean men's singles have no victory.
